All-New 2025 Audi A5 Replaces Previous A5 and A4

Competes with: BMW 4 Series Gran Coupe, Genesis G70, Mercedes-Benz C-Class, Volvo S60
Looks like: The staid A4 and swoopy A5 Sportback merged into one
Powertrains: 268-horsepower, turbocharged 2.0-liter four-cylinder or 362-hp, turbocharged 3.0-liter V-6 engine; seven-speed dual-clutch automatic transmission; all-wheel drive
Hits dealerships: Spring 2025
As buyers continue to migrate from sedans into SUVs, the luxury market is something of a refuge for traditional definitions of “car.” But Audi has decided that haven is no longer strong enough to support two competing products, and the new mid-size 2025 A5 sedan replaces both its predecessor and its mechanical twin, the A4 (the previously announced 2025 A4 is no longer available to order, according to an Audi spokesperson).

How Much Bigger Is the 2025 A5?
The all-new sedan rides on the Volkswagen Group’s Premium Platform Combustion, not to be confused with the Premium Platform Electric architecture that underpins the automaker’s electric vehicles, such as the Audi Q6 E-Tron and Porsche Macan EV. With styling that bridges the slab-sided look of the A4 and the outgoing A5’s taut curves, the new car is 2.6 inches longer, 1.6 inches taller, 0.5 inch wider and has a 2.8-inch longer wheelbase than the outgoing A4. There’s also 22.6 cubic feet of cargo volume under the hatchback and 36.6 cubic feet with the rear seats folded, per Audi’s measurements.
Audi also says the new architecture will result in greater steering fidelity than the outgoing A5, with sturdier steering rack mounting and axle designs. As before, a steel spring setup will be standard on both the A5 and the higher-performance S5 — though the latter sits 0.8 inch lower — and an adaptive suspension will be available for the S5.
What Are the A5’s Powertrain Specs?
For 2025, the A5’s standard engine remains a turbocharged 2.0-liter four-cylinder, but Audi found enough additional output to surpass not only the 2024 model’s base engine, but its high-output version, as well. Generating 268 horsepower and 295 pounds-feet of torque, 2025 A5 betters the 2024 model’s base powertrain by 7 hp and 22 pounds-feet.
The S5 is likewise still powered by a turbocharged 3.0-liter V-6. Now putting out 362 hp and 406 pounds-feet of torque, it tops the outgoing model by 13 hp and 37 pounds-feet. Whereas the old A4 and A5 were available with either a seven-speed dual-clutch automatic transmission or traditional eight-speed automatic, depending on the engine, the new 2025 A5 uses a seven-speed dual-clutch automatic in all applications. Quattro all-wheel drive is, of course, standard.












What Interior Updates Are There?
Audi’s interior designs age so well that the outgoing A5 doesn’t look outdated even after seven years on the market — until it’s placed alongside the new A5’s. Following the trend in luxury and mass-market vehicles alike, the A5 now sports a fully digitized dashboard that Audi calls Digital Stage. Now neatly integrated into a single curved display rather than the distinct instrument panel and infotainment screen of yore, the Digital Stage consists of an 11.9-inch digital gauge cluster and 14.5-inch touchscreen.
A 10.9-inch passenger display is optional, and a bezel neatly integrates it into the dash to prevent it from looking like an afterthought. There’s also a new available head-up display that provides sharper graphics and is 85% larger than the one in the previous A5. It also integrates more functions, with buttons on the steering wheel and voice recognition powered by artificial intelligence helping drivers to control more vehicle systems without taking their eyes off the road.
High-style tech being a cornerstone of Audi’s self-image, the A5 is available with LED daytime running lights offering eight customizable lighting signatures. Organic light-emitting diode taillights are also available. Audi also offers two different Bang & Olufsen audio systems with up to 20 speakers in the new A5. In the premier setup, four of those speakers are integrated into the front-seat head restraints, allowing the system to localize phone calls and navigation instructions to just the driver’s seat.

How Much Will the 2025 A5 Cost?
The all-new 2025 Audi A5 goes on sale in the second quarter of this year. At a base price of $48,995 (all prices include the $1,295 destination charge), it is $500 less expensive than the outgoing A5 and $3,600 pricier than the base A4. The 2025 S5 starts at $61,195, which is $2,600 more than its predecessor and $5,000 more than the old S4.
